U.S. stocks close mixed


NEW YORK, Jan. 13 (Xinhua) -- U.S. stocks ended mixed on Monday.

The Dow Jones Industrial Average rose 358.67 points, or 0.86 percent, to 42,297.12. The S&P 500 added 9.18 points, or 0.16 percent, to 5,836.22. The Nasdaq Composite Index shed 73.53 points, or 0.38 percent, to 19,088.1.

Seven of the 11 primary S&P 500 sectors ended in green, with energy and materials leading the gainers by rising 2.25 percent and 2.21 percent, respectively. Meanwhile, utilities and technology led the laggards by dropping 1.19 percent and 0.87 percent, respectively.
